Durag With Detachable Hook And Pile Tail
Find Innovative SolutionsGenerate Solutions
Solution Overview
Problem
Durags are cumbersome to secure and remove, especially when washing hair, which can cause waves to deteriorate and lose their form.
Innovation Solution
A durag design featuring a detachable tail with hook and pile fasteners, allowing for adjustable and snug fitting around the head, and made of breathable, porous material to facilitate easy washing without compromising hair wave patterns.
